Re: Playback Quality Not As Good As Live TV
Ok, so here's the deal...I watched a recorded version of the evening news with Brian Williams tonight BEFORE BTV showsqueezed the video and the picture was GREAT, just like watching live. Therefore, it must be the showqueezing that's causing the problem. Any ideas on how to fix this?

Re: Playback Quality Not As Good As Live TV
In the BTV Web Admin, under Settings - Basic Settings - ShowSqueeze. I use DivX HD (High) for my ClearQAM HD recordings and it works great.
